Summary of differences between kung Pao chicken and molasses

  • Kung Pao chicken has more vitamin A; however, molasses are higher in manganese, magnesium, iron, copper, potassium, vitamin B6, calcium, and selenium.
  • Molasses cover your daily need for manganese, 55% more than kung Pao chicken.
  • Molasses have less sodium.
